On May 17th, Connecticut Governor Dannel Malloy signed a new bill into law addressing previous concerns about minors not having access to medical marijuana should they need it. Before the bill, Connecticut was the only state with a legalized medical marijuana program that excluded patients under the age of 18. House Bill 5450 calls for […]

Understanding that epileptic seizures in children don’t necessarily happen when it’s convenient. A newly introduced piece of legislation, Delaware’s Senate bill 181, would allow schools in the Small Wonder state to keep on hand and permit the administration of cannabis oil for those students in need.
